My brother got a gig testing recipes for another chef’s cookbook that is about to come out. I guess it is normal for chefs and restaurants to put out recipe books but never test the recipes and then when the customer tries to make a dish it turns out like shit and they leave a bad review. According to Dave this happens all the time. So all the legit recipe book people will pay cooks like my brother to actually cook the food as per directed and then give notes on what works and what doesn’t. Anyways, more free food for me.
